All seasons of TAR: China Rush, both seasons of TAR: Philippines, and the 1st and 4th seasons of TAR: Vietnam, are the only seasons of The Amazing Race to take place entirely within a single Time Zone.

Not one, not two, not three, but FOUR of the eliminations on Season 38 took place in exact locations where teams had previously been eliminated on international versions.
Museumplein, Amsterdam was where Jack & Enzo were eliminated, but previously Vova & Alla were eliminated there on HaMerotz LaMillion 8
Buda Castle, Budapest was where Kat & Alex were eliminated, but previously Nitzan & Fifi were eliminated there on HaMerotz LaMillion 2
Carol Park, Bucharest was where Natalie & Stephanie were eliminated, but previously Jani & Maria were eliminated there on Amazing Race Suomi 2
Kotzia Square, Athens was where Tucker & Eric were eliminated, but previously Sam & Alex were eliminated there on The Amazing Race Australia 6

The only leg that was never won by an all-male team on TAR38 was Leg 3 (Natalie & Stephanie); because even Jag & Jas were too good that they chose to let another team win a leg instead of them. If Jag & Jas didn't let Natalie & Stephanie take over the win from them and won the leg instead, the season would've had 100% of its leg wins coming from the all-male teams with only two of them (Jag & Jas and Tucker & Eric) ever winning legs in total. Plus, Jag & Jas would've tied the record with Rachel & Dave on having the most number of first place wins on a season (8 in total) which means they would've won 2/3 of the legs while Tucker & Eric won 1/3 of the legs.
